AuthorRavi Guttal and Jacob Fish
TitleHierarchical assumed strain-vorticity shell element with drilling degrees of freedom
Year1998
AbstractThe formulation of stabilized assumed strain-vorticity degenerated shell element with six degrees-of-freedom per mode is developed. The penalty formulation is employed to alleviate rank deficiency caused by drilling degrees-of-freedom. The assumed strain-vorticity formulation for p-type shell elements is utilized to circumvent membrane and shear locking at lower polynomials as well as locking associated with the penalty formulation. Numerical experiments are conducted to test the element performance.
